Coolest Lamp Shade Styles
1. Rattan & Woven Shades
Natural, airy, and perfect for creating warm, cozy light.
Best for: Bohemian, coastal, and rustic interiors.
Why Cool: Casts beautiful patterns on walls and ceilings.
2. Marble-Effect Lamp Shades
Sleek and luxurious without the heavy weight.
Best for: Modern and minimalist spaces.
Why Cool: Adds a sophisticated stone look to lighting.
3. Metallic Statement Shades
Brass, copper, and brushed gold for a touch of glam.
Best for: Art deco, industrial, and luxury homes.
Why Cool: Reflects light for a warm, rich glow.
4. Patterned Fabric Shades
Bold florals, geometrics, or abstract prints.
Best for: Eclectic and maximalist décor.
Why Cool: Acts as both functional lighting and wall art.
5. Glass & Stained Glass Shades
From Tiffany-inspired designs to frosted glass.
Best for: Vintage, cottage, or artistic interiors.
Why Cool: Creates colorful, artistic lighting effects.
6. Minimalist Drum Shades
Clean, cylindrical shapes in neutral tones.
Best for: Scandinavian, modern, and understated interiors.
Why Cool: Timeless and blends with almost any décor.
7. Pleated Shades
Classic but making a big comeback in bold colors and patterns.
Best for: Retro, vintage, and Parisian-style homes.
Why Cool: Adds texture and elegance to any lamp.
Materials That Make Lamp Shades Stand Out
-
Linen: Soft light diffusion with a natural feel.
-
Silk: Luxurious glow and refined elegance.
-
Metal: Industrial and modern edge.
-
Rattan/Bamboo: Eco-friendly, organic vibe.
-
Velvet: Plush texture with rich depth.
Tips for Choosing the Coolest Lamp Shade
-
Match the Base & Shade Size: A mismatched scale can look awkward.
-
Play with Contrast: Pair a sleek base with a bold shade—or vice versa.
-
Think About Lighting Effect: Dark shades create mood lighting, light shades spread more brightness.
-
Switch Seasonally: Lighter fabrics in summer, rich textures in winter.
-
Go Custom: Commission a one-of-a-kind design for maximum uniqueness.
